    Noticing that when users are being banned they aren't being directed to the banpool and are showing up as banned/banished in the main pool. I've checked banpool power and its assigned, nothing was/has changed and this has persisted since this morning (07/07/2021). Please verify on your end if this is an issue that is exclusive to one chat or if this is happening at other chats too,

    Thank you

     

    Banish and Rankpool are assigned correctly too, incase you were wondering. Everything was always working fine until this morning


    Steps to reproduce bug:

    There are no steps needed to be listed to reproduce the bug. You simply ban someone and they're expected to go to banpool, providing that the power is assigned and working. Screenshots show the ban and the user still staying in the main pool. I've tried this on 1 hour ban too by the way, same result. There are also forever banned users being able to watch the chat.

    This is definitely a bug on xat's side (I just had the same experience), and to add onto it:

    If you get banned or banished, you're able to go into the banpool and you'll be stuck there, unless you refresh. Refreshing will put the banned/banished user back into main chat.

    Also after being unbanned, you would have to refresh the chat otherwise you won't see any messages sent.

  • Priority Definitions

     

    Trivial The issue is considered low priority.

    Normal This is the default priority.

    High A feature or service is not working properly, and it impacts a lot of people. The issue should be fixed in the near future.

    Critical The issue is show-stopping, meaning that a certain feature or service is completely broken with no available workaround. The issue impacts a lot of people and requires immediate repair.

  • Status Definitions

     

    Open The issue is pending, or we are still working on the issue.

    Fixed The issue has been resolved. The fix may not be immediately noticeable and may be released in a future version or update.

    Closed This record is either not considered an issue or is better suited as a suggestion. If it is an issue, it may not be reproducible.

    Won't Fix The issue will not be fixed because it is too low in priority. The issue is very minor. The resources required to fix the issue cannot justify the benefits received from fixing the issue. This means the issue is closed.
